Dude, I'm trying to figure out how big of a budget and what equipment you had to get shots like that. Happen to have a link to the videos? Because the second shot is one I would definitely would like to see what it looks like in action. | |||

We pretty much had a budget of virutally nothing on that first one. The second one was made with a budget of roughly $1500, not including the lights themselves. We had a kit of about 8 lights (an ARRI light kit including a 650 watt, 300 watt, and two 150 watt fresnel lights, A kit of 3 KW/2 color balanced flourescent lights, and an ARRI 575 HMI) All other lighting equipment like gels, diffusion, and things like fog machines were rented/bought and paid for out of our budget. Static was shot with a Sony PD-150, and Penance was shot with a Sony HDR-FX1 (HDV format).
